Creating Effective Patient Wipe Liquids

Formulating effective patient wipe liquids requires a meticulous combination of ingredients to provide both performance and complacency. Key considerations include the selection of suitable disinfectants, humectants, and surfactants. The ratio of these ingredients must be carefully optimized to achieve the desired standard of disinfection. Moreover, mixtures should be structured to be non-irritating on delicate skin while delivering a acceptable user perception.

  • Additionally, the option of packaging materials has a vital role in retaining the potency of the wipe liquid over time.
  • Thorough quality control measures are indispensable to guarantee that patient wipe liquids consistently meet all relevant standards for safety and performance.

Formulating the Perfect Wet Wipe Base: Liquid Considerations

The base of a wet wipe lies in its liquid. This essential component determines the wipe's ability to clean. When picking a liquid for your wet wipes, think about factors like wetting ability, pH level, and natural decomposition. A compatible liquid ensures the wipe can effectively eliminate dirt, grime, and bacteria while remaining gentle on surfaces.

Examining Wet Wipe Ingredients: Safety and Effectiveness

With the popularity of wet wipes in our daily lives, it's essential to grasp what's truly inside these convenient cleaning tools. Although they offer a quick and easy solution for various tasks, the ingredients in some wet wipes can be somewhat complex. This discussion aims to uncover the common components found in wet wipes, their potential effects on our health and the environment, and how to choose healthier options.

First, let's explore the main ingredients that make up most wet wipes. These include liquid as the foundation, surfactants to eliminate dirt and grime, and additives to enhance shelf life.

Furthermore, some wet wipes also feature additional ingredients like fragrances, dyes, and even moisturizers. These additions can turn out to be useful for certain applications, but they can also pose issues regarding potential irritations.

Consequently, it's crucial to scrutinize the ingredient list carefully before choosing wet wipes. Look for products that are lacking in irritating chemicals and prefer those with eco-friendly ingredients whenever available.

The Science Behind Wet Wipe Liquids: Formulation and Function

Wet wipes are ubiquitous conveniences, found in homes, offices, and even our backpacks. Their effectiveness lies in their ability to quickly clean various surfaces with minimal effort. But have you ever stopped to consider the science behind these seemingly simple wipes? The solution within a wet wipe is carefully designed to achieve optimal cleaning efficacy.

A typical wet wipe solution consists of several key components. Water serves as the primary component, providing the copyright for other active ingredients. Surfactants, also known as cleaning agents, play a crucial role in removing dirt and grime by reducing surface tension.

In addition to surfactants, wet wipes often contain humectants, which help to maintain moisture and prevent the wipes from drying out too quickly. These ingredients can include glycerin or propylene glycol. Stabilizers are also commonly included to prevent bacterial growth.

  • Depending on the intended use, wet wipe solutions may also contain additional ingredients such as alcohols for disinfection, fragrances for a pleasant scent, or conditioning agents to soften the skin.
